AN ISLE of Wight man accused of stabbing another man in Shanklin last week will go before a judge later this year.

Aaron David Caley, of Pellhurst Road, Ryde, appeared before Isle of Wight magistrates on Monday, June 24.

The 36-year-old is charged with wounding with intent and possession of a knife, blade, or sharp pointed article in a public place.

He did not enter a plea and saw his case adjourned to July 29 at the Isle of Wight Crown Court.

On Friday, June 21, police were called to a serious assault on Shanklin High Street at around 6.20pm.

It was reported a man in his 50s had been stabbed, suffering a puncture wound to his back and a cut on his arm.

He was immediately taken by the Isle of Wight Ambulance Service to St Mary's Hospital.
